Re: Update as of 6/26
Just to second Tightlines01 - we spent 8 days on the island from June 21 - 28 and hiked Windigo to Rock Harbor along the Greenstone. Mosquitoes were worse on the Windigo end - the canopy covered swampy, humid forest areas (obviously). We used head nets occasionally, but with a nice layer of DEET ...

Re: Water treatment?
We're taking the Sawyer 4L gravity filtration system this year (http://sawyer.com/products/sawyer-complete-4-liter-dual-bag-water-purifier-system/)... it works great for larger groups. They also have a 2L version for smaller groups. It can filter 4 liters (or 4 Nalgene bottles approx) of water in 3 ...
